    Quote Originally Posted by Faddenator
    Yeah it will if it gets too bad. The testers are not very expensive, you can get them at any garden surplus store, and probably most hardware stores. not to mention on the net. Basically what you want to do to fix it is adjust the pH of your water so it is right in the 6.5 - 7 range, then water generously ONLY when the top layer of soil is bone dry. If you wake up one day and the whole plant is drooping, just water it asap and by the end of the day it should be good. :smokin:

    A little advise, you should try to figure out when the plant need water and water it a little bit before the look droopy, as this may cause some stress and slow down the growing pace. You are lucky that you don't have any signs of deficiencies, maybe you're soil is rich in nutriments... But, eventually it will start to get hungry, better get ready to give it some "food". But don't misunderstand me the plant look great and you're doing a great job! :thumbsup:

    Looking at your pics gives me the itch again. I used MH/HPS switchable light and would start flowering them at about 6" tall. They would already have 2-4 nodes on the m though. I've never tried CFL's. If you do get into height problems, you can always tie branches down to where they are horizontal. This is best done early while the stems are still rubbery and bendable. Also, have you read about supercropping? Interesting stuff. For a first timer, you seem to know what you're doing. Keep it up.
